Messerschmitt Bf 109 (Airlife)

One of the truly great military aircraft of all time - the Bf 109 exemplified the Wartime Luftwaffe.  It was built in larger numbers than any other type committed to combat by Germany or the Allies and the total number of aerial victories scored by its pilots is very unlikely ever to be approached.

This history starts with the pre-war prototype development and flight testing and the first combat missions in the Spanish Civil War.  The book traces the evolution of the different models from the 109B through to the 109K; it looks at the different roles that the aircraft played throughout the war and the varied battlegrounds over which it flew.  There are comprehensive details of surviving aircraft.

Author:  Jerry Scutts

Medium hardback format, 146 pages, with many black and white photographs throughout

ISBN : 1 85310 557 0
